Explanation:

A) what are the x intercepts

X- axis interception points of x²+ 4x– 12:

(2,0), (-6,0)

B)what is the y intercepts

Y-axis interception point of x² + 4X – 12:

(0, – 12)

X Intercepts: (2, 0), (-6, 0), Y Intercepts: (0, – 12)

C)what is the maximum and minimum value

Parabola equation in polynomial form

The parabola params are:

a=1, b=4,c= -12

xv= -b/2a

xv= -4/2.1

simplify

xv=-2

Plug in xv = -2 to find the yv value

yv= -16

Therefore the parabola vertex is (-2, – 16)

If a<0. then the vertex is a maximum value

If a>0. then the vertex is a minimum value

a=1

minimum=(-2,-16)
